As an education and public outreach (E/PO) specialist working for SSAI within the Hydrospheric and Biospheric Sciences Lab at GSFC, I want to be sure that the primary messages -- the biggest ideas -- from our E/PO discussions here do come across. These are they:

A lot of highly useful strategic thinking about E/PO has taken place recently across the agency. David Herring’s Excellence in Outreach workshop took place just this last June. See Report on our Education and Outreach breakout site, and other strategic planning documents.

A lot of worthwhile, very good programs are going on.
This community can link to them for high leveraging and support by professional education and outreach personnel. Find them by talking with E/PO personnel at NASA centers, and let us know about the ones you’re aware of!

We can do a lot with a little, through partnerships.

Education and Outreach personnel at GSFC want to work across missions, thematically as scientists do.
Funding comes in pipes which has the effect of segregating us.
SO:

Enable more thematic, interdisciplinary approaches to education -- themes based on science -- primarily by rewarding cross-mission collaboration in education efforts funded by HQ
and by supporting communication within this group.
